When it comes to building houses, neighborhoods, towns, the old way was spread out and everyone gets a yard to mow.

The new way is to grow up, literally.

"Up instead of Out"

It is very efficient to stack humans, because then they can all share a central heating, water, and recycling system. It is a very social way to live, not to mention one very important aspect: you don't have to park a car. You don't even have to own one.

So, instead of a huge expanse of identical tract houses, (shudder...) think instead of one beautiful eco-tower, sitting amidst unspoiled wilderness.

What if you had five families, each in their own house, and each house on one acre of land. What if the five families got together, created a beautiful, environmentally sustainable five-unit building, and then they worked together to rehab the land formerly occupied by their old houses? Then you've got five happy families who can support and entertain each other, now free to enjoy a four acre park surrounding their masterpiece. Marvelous.
